Health & Safety Trainer (Fire, Construction, Environmental)

Health & Safety Trainer (Fire, Construction, Environmental)

Gower College Swansea
This is an exciting opportunity for a suitably qualified trainer to join our highly successful and professional team, operating within GCS Training, the commercial branch of the College.

The successful candidates will be training, assessing and coaching learners within the health and safety sector.

Working with employers to diagnose, support and implement training solutions to meet the needs of the particular organisation, you will provide a seamless learning experience that develops the individual and aids skills improvements. Awarding bodies include NEBOSH, IOSH, City & Guilds and Highfield. Programmes include accredited courses, bespoke training and consultancy.

With a proven track record of working in a health and safety role you will have relevant commercial knowledge, experience and an understanding of the qualifications including training needs.

You will possess a level 4 qualification or equivalent in Health & Safety; preferably NEBOSH Diploma, and hold a NEBOSH General Certificate. A recognised teaching qualification, A1 assessor award and a background in either construction, environmental and/or fire would be advantageous.
